How to make it

  • Pan-fry the eggs into thin sheets in a frying pan. Remove and cut into
  • small strips.
  • Heat peanut oil over high heat. Stir-fry shrimp and chicken. When done,
  • sizzle in 1 tsp. wine.
  • Add the cooked rice. Stir until well-mixed. Add 1 tbsp. soy sauce, 1/4
  • tsp. MSG and the diced green onion. Add 1 tsp. salt (or more). Stir-frry
  • for at least 10 minutes over MEDIUM heat. Add egg strips.
  • Serve hot.
